University of Oxford Associate Professorship in African Studies 2026: The University of Oxford is calling for applications from candidates who have received a doctorate in a social sciences discipline, history or cultural studies with special reference to Africa for employment as Associate Professorship in African Studies. The deadline for the submission of applications for the University of Oxford Associate Professorship in African Studies is 14th April 2026.
University of Oxford Associate Professorship in African Studies 2026 is now accepting applications. The Oxford School of Global and Area Studies (OSGA), in association with Corpus Christi College, seek to appoint an Associate Professor in African Studies from 1 September 2026, or as soon as possible thereafter.

University of Oxford Associate Professorship in African Studies 2026.
They invite applicants with expertise in a social sciences discipline, history or cultural studies with special reference to Africa. Interdisciplinary skills are welcomed, and preference may be given to someone who works in South Africa.
You will be expected to teach and supervise at the graduate level and to engage in research and administration. The post will be held in conjunction with a Governing Body Fellowship (non-stipendiary) at Corpus Christi College. You will engage actively in research to contribute through publication to the department’s and University’s international reputation for research excellence.

Who can Apply
- You should have received a doctorate in a social sciences discipline, history or cultural studies with special reference to Africa, by September 1, 2026.
- The successful candidate will demonstrate:
- Research achievement at an international level appropriate to the stage of their career;
- The skills and commitment to contribute effectively to teaching, supervision and academic administration in the School;
- A record of success in obtaining research funding or commitment to doing so.
Benefits
- The salary range is between £48,114 to £64,605 per annum.

The closing date for applications is Wednesday 14 April 2026. interviews will be held in May 2026.
